It was last month when WABetaInfo reported that WhatsApp is working towards adding support for multiple devices and it was spotted in the development phase. The clues about the feature, have again been spotted in the latest Android Beta update 2.20.143.

What's App

For those of you who are unaware of what the feature is all about, it’s a multi-device feature, meaning, it would allow users to operate the same WhatsApp account on different devices at the same time. This, in turn, would allow you to use the same account on your Android device as well as a tablet.

WhatsApp multi-device support spotted in Android beta; allows us to use the same WhatsApp account on multiple devices. The feature is under development right now and might be released for everyone soon.

WhatsApp is continuously working on improving the platform and make it a de-facto mode of communication for everyone. It has already increased the limit from 4 to 8 participants on WhatsApp Group calls for both video and voice calls, and now it appears to be readying itself to make the multi-device support available to its users.

The feature would allow users to use the same WhatsApp account on more than one device. If you own a tablet, then you will be allowed to use your WhatsApp account on your phone as well as your tablet at the same time, once the functionality is made available on the app.

As of now, WhatsApp users are allowed to log in only on one device. But, this might change soon as the multi-device has been spotted in the latest Android beta version, which means the feature is under development right now and might be released for everyone soon.
